I assume that you appealed a Fit for Work Decision.

Unless you also met one of the Support Group descriptors, 27 points will place you in the WRAG, it is a common misconception that you are now expected to work, this is not the case, in fact you are not even required to seek work while you are in the WRAG, but you are expected to take part in Work Related Activity. If your current award is the result of a Tribunal hearing, rather than a Reconsideration by the DWP, then your options are very limited as you can only challenge the Decision if you can show there was an Error of Law in the proceedings, see

What is an Error of Law?

Tribunals – Requesting a Statement of Reasons

If the Decision was made by the DWP, then you can lodge an appeal.

In either case, if you can show that your condition has deteriorated, such that you now believe you meet the requirements for the SG, you can ask to be re-assessed on this basis.
